sage、sagetex、環境を使用して時間を測定する方法を示したいと思いますsagecommandline
。以下は最小限の例です。
\documentclass[a6paper,DIV=16]{scrartcl}
\pagestyle{empty}
\usepackage{sagetex}
% arara: lualatex
% arara: sagetex
% arara: lualatex
% !TEX encoding = UTF-8 Unicode
% !TEX TS-program = sage
\begin{document}
\begin{sagecommandline}
sage: factorial(10)
sage: %time factorial(10)
sage: \percent time factorial(10)
\end{sagecommandline}
\end{document}
しかし、どちらも目的の出力を生成しませ%time
ん\percent
。マイクロ秒を含む出力を含めることは可能ですか? 私のマシンでは、例えば次のようになります:
CPU times: user 11 µs, sys: 0 ns, total: 11 µs Wall time: 14.1 µs 3628800